How It Works
Vision & Scope
We start with a detailed walkthrough to understand how you actually use the home and where the current layout falls short, then define a realistic scope.
Design Coordination
We collaborate with architects and designers — yours or ours — to finalize plans before demolition starts, minimizing surprises once walls come down.
Phased Construction
For occupied renovations, we sequence work to keep at least part of the home livable where possible, and communicate clearly when that isn't.
Final Finishes & Walkthrough
We close out trade by trade with a documented punch list, so the last 10% of the project gets the same attention as the first.

Frequently Asked
Can we stay in the home during a full renovation?
It depends on scope — for renovations that leave part of the home intact, many clients stay. For projects touching structural systems throughout, we'll be upfront if temporary relocation makes more sense, and help you plan around it.
How do you handle unexpected issues once walls are opened?
Older Orange County homes often reveal outdated wiring, plumbing, or water damage once demolition starts. We document any change orders with cost and schedule impact before proceeding, rather than surprising you on the next invoice.
Do you work with our architect or interior designer?
Yes, regularly. We can also bring in our own design partners if you're starting from scratch.
How long does a whole-home renovation typically take?
Timelines depend heavily on scope, square footage, and how many systems are being touched. We'll give you a project-specific schedule once the design is finalized.
